Overview of the Seesii Mini Chainsaw and W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w

When comparing the Seesii Mini Chainsaw and the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w, the first noticeable difference is their power source and design purpose. The Seesii Mini Chainsaw is a cordless electric model, while the WTHW chainsaw relies on a gas-powered engine. This fundamental distinction shapes their usability, efficiency, and ideal applications, making each suitable for different users and tasks.

The Seesii Mini Chainsaw, priced at $37.97, is designed for light to moderate tasks such as tree trimming and wood cutting, particularly in residential settings. Its lightweight (2.7 pounds) and one-handed operation make it accessible for a wider audience, including women and those with limited strength. In contrast, the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w, priced at $149.99, targets more demanding jobs with its robust 58cc engine. This chainsaw is ideal for larger projects, such as felling trees, and offers the advantage of extended runtime due to its larger fuel tank.

Power and Performance

The Seesii Mini Chainsaw is equipped with a powerful 900W motor that allows cutting speeds up to 30 ft/s, making it efficient for quick tasks. It can cut through wood up to 15 cm thick in just 7 seconds, providing substantial cutting performance for its size.

On the other hand, the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w features a 58cc engine, which is designed for heavy-duty cutting tasks. Its larger fuel tank enables longer operation times without frequent refueling. The chainsaw can switch between a 20-inch and an 18-inch bar quickly, accommodating different cutting needs, which adds to its versatility for various applications in the yard or forest.

Cutting Capacity

In terms of cutting capacity, the Seesii Mini Chainsaw excels in its segment, allowing users to trim branches and small trees efficiently. With a focus on ease of use, it is particularly beneficial for individuals who may struggle with heavier equipment.

Conversely, the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w is engineered for larger jobs, making it suitable for both felling and limbing thanks to its quick-switch bar system. This chainsaw can handle substantial logs and trees, making it a more rugged choice for serious woodworkers or those needing a reliable tool for substantial jobs.

User Experience and Ergonomics

The Seesii Mini Chainsaw is designed with user comfort in mind. Weighing only 2.7 pounds, it allows for one-handed operation without causing fatigue, making it particularly suitable for users with limited physical strength. Its ergonomic design enhances grip and control, ensuring a comfortable experience during extended use.

In contrast, while the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w is heavier and requires two hands for operation, it is built with features for safety and comfort, such as a dual-spring anti-vibration system and a fast-acting inertial chain brake. This design helps users maintain control during operation, particularly when cutting through denser materials.

Safety Features

Safety is paramount in any power tool, and both the Seesii Mini Chainsaw and the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w incorporate essential safety features. The Seesii model has a double safety lock to prevent accidental activation and a chain guard to shield users from flying debris. It operates quietly, which is a bonus for those concerned about noise pollution in residential areas.

Meanwhile, the WTHW chainsaw includes a fast-acting inertial chain brake and low-kickback chain, enhancing user safety during operation. Its centrifugal air filter system is designed to protect the engine from dust and debris, contributing to a longer lifespan and fewer work stoppages, which is crucial for professionals and avid DIYers alike.

Battery Life vs. Fuel Efficiency

The Seesii Mini Chainsaw comes with two 21V 2000 mAh batteries, providing up to 80-100 minutes of operation, making it well-suited for tasks that require less time and effort. This battery life allows for extended use without interruptions, ideal for garden pruning and light wood cutting.

The W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w, while having no battery to worry about, operates on a 58cc engine with a larger fuel tank, allowing for more extended periods of heavy use before needing to refuel. This chainsaw is better suited for all-day projects, where users can benefit from its efficiency and power without the constraints of battery life.

Price Comparison

The Seesii Mini Chainsaw is priced at $37.97, making it about 75% cheaper than the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w, which retails at $149.99. This significant price difference reflects their market positioning: the Seesii is aimed at casual users and those needing a light-duty tool, while the WTHW is for professionals or serious hobbyists willing to invest in a more powerful and versatile chainsaw.

While the lower price of the Seesii Mini Chainsaw makes it an attractive option for budget-conscious consumers, the WTHW Gas Powered Chainsaw offers features and performance that justify its higher price point for those needing a robust tool for demanding tasks.
